Who can vote to elect the members of Parliament?

  1. A Australian citizens aged 18 and over โœ“ Correct
  2. B Anyone living in Australia
  3. C Only property owners
  4. D Only members of political parties

โœ… Correct answer: A โ€” Australian citizens aged 18 and over

๐Ÿ’ก Explanation

Australian citizens aged 18 and over are entitled and required to vote in elections.
